Overview of Jet Boat Brands
When you explore the world of jet boat brands, you'll find a diverse range of options catering to various recreational needs and preferences.
Yamaha stands out as a top choice, offering some of the best jet boats that range from 19 to 27 feet. Their innovative designs not only focus on aesthetics but also achieve impressive top speeds, ensuring thrilling experiences on the water.
Scarab also captures attention with its fiberglass pleasure boats, particularly the Wake and Multi-Sport lines. These boats, ranging from 15.9 to 28 feet, are designed with hull shapes that enhance performance, powered by reliable BRP Rotax inboards.
If you're looking for compact options, AB Inflatables provides jet tenders from 9.6 to 15 feet, featuring both diesel and gasoline engines.
For a luxurious experience, Argo Nautic's Jet 9.5 and Jet 11 models offer customization options that can match your larger mother ship's aesthetics.
Lastly, G3 specializes in aluminum fishing boats like the Gator Tough Tunnel Jons, which have a minimal draft for traversing rocky rivers.
Each brand brings unique hull shapes and features, so you'll definitely find the right fit for your jet boating adventures.
Notable Features of Jet Boats

Jet boats offer remarkable maneuverability in shallow waters and rocky rapids, making them ideal for thrilling recreational activities and watersports. One standout feature is their ability to operate at low RPM, allowing for smooth navigation through tight spaces and shallow areas without sacrificing power. This capability is particularly beneficial when you're trying to avoid obstacles or explore narrow waterways.
Additionally, many jet boats come with advanced technologies like the Helm Master EX joystick controls, which enhance handling and provide a more intuitive driving experience. The Kima K7 model showcases 16 industry-first features, elevating both luxury and performance. You'll appreciate innovations such as closed-loop cooling systems that guarantee durability in saltwater and DTIC Optimus digital power steering for precise control.
Most jet boats also include substantial ballast systems, like the impressive 3,000 lbs of factory ballast found in Kima boats, which considerably boosts surf performance. With these notable features, jet boats not only promise excitement on the water but also deliver a user-friendly experience, making them a top choice for enthusiasts looking to maximize their fun.

Innovative Engineering Trends

What innovative engineering trends are shaping the future of jet boats? You'll find that advancements like the Rous charged Raptor 575 engine are at the forefront, delivering an impressive 580 ft-lbs of torque derived from Ford's 6.2L V8 Superduty block. This engine showcases the push for more powerful and efficient marine applications.
Kima Boats is also leading the charge with their focus on quiet and efficient jet performance. They've integrated cutting-edge technologies, such as MyA telematics, which enhance your overall user experience on the water. Additionally, their DTIC Optimus digital power steering system offers you precision control, greatly improving handling capabilities.
Durability is another key trend, especially with Kima's closed-loop cooling system, designed to withstand harsh saltwater environments. This commitment to longevity and performance is essential for any serious boater.
In addition, the Kima K7 model introduces 16 industry-first features, blending luxury with high performance. These innovations not only elevate the user experience but also set new standards in the jet boat market, ensuring that you enjoy both comfort and cutting-edge technology on your adventures.
